Insertion Tool for One-Way Shelf Supports
This insertion tool is designed for fitting one-way shelf supports cleanly and accurately into cabinet panels, wardrobes, shelving units and fitted furniture. It helps installers seat the shelf fitting securely while reducing the risk of damage to the surrounding board surface.
Key Features
- Designed for installing one-way shelf support fittings
- Helps achieve consistent seating and a tidy finished result
- Useful for cabinet makers, furniture manufacturers and kitchen fitters
- Suitable for workshop production or on-site installation work
Typical Applications
- Kitchen cabinets and larder units
- Bedroom wardrobes and storage furniture
- Retail display shelving
- General fitted furniture and cabinet assembly
Why Choose This Tool?
Using the correct insertion tool helps protect both the fitting and the panel. It gives the installer better control than improvised methods and supports a more consistent result across repeated shelf-support installations.
